Output 72ec83a78a4a9918c1345d00c679ea205901c0ef6f23c6cad51d0045a5fed72c:0

value
2272133
script pubkey
OP_0 OP_PUSHBYTES_20 850e38c764237f4bb92e544ead4c3bb9812817b9
address
bc1qs58r33myydl5hwfw23826npmhxqjs9ae9ntdy0
transaction
72ec83a78a4a9918c1345d00c679ea205901c0ef6f23c6cad51d0045a5fed72c
confirmations
174293
spent
true